Kembali ke blog
Januari 19, 2026Panduan

Cara Menginstal Proxy VLESS dengan Panel Marzban

Panduan langkah demi langkah lengkap tentang cara mengatur proxy VLESS menggunakan panel Marzban - antarmuka manajemen yang modern dan ramah pengguna dengan dukungan multi-protokol.

Cara Menginstal Proxy VLESS dengan Panel Marzban

Marzban adalah panel berbasis web yang kuat dan modern untuk mengelola server proxy Xray. Tidak seperti panel lainnya, Marzban menawarkan antarmuka yang intuitif, dukungan multi-admin, dan fitur manajemen pengguna yang komprehensif. Panduan ini akan menunjukkan cara mengatur proxy VLESS menggunakan Marzban di VPS Hiddence Anda untuk akses internet yang aman dan tahan sensor.

Apa itu Marzban?

Marzban adalah panel manajemen proxy open-source yang terintegrasi dengan Telegram yang dibangun khusus untuk Xray-core. Ini menyediakan dasbor yang bersih dan modern untuk membuat dan mengelola pengguna proxy, memantau lalu lintas, dan menangani langganan. Marzban mendukung protokol VLESS, VMess, Trojan, dan Shadowsocks.

Mengapa Memilih Marzban?

  • Antarmuka Web Modern: Dasbor yang bersih dan responsif yang dapat diakses dari browser mana pun
  • Dukungan Multi-Admin: Buat beberapa akun admin dengan izin yang berbeda
  • Manajemen Pengguna: Pembuatan, modifikasi, dan penghapusan pengguna proxy yang mudah
  • Pemantauan Lalu Lintas: Statistik waktu nyata dan pelacakan penggunaan per pengguna
  • Tautan Langganan: Pembuatan otomatis URL langganan untuk klien
  • Bot Telegram: Bot bawaan untuk manajemen pengguna dan notifikasi
  • Multi-Protokol: Mendukung VLESS, VMess, Trojan, dan Shadowsocks
  • Berbasis Docker: Instalasi dan pembaruan yang mudah menggunakan Docker

Prasyarat

  • VPS baru dengan Ubuntu 22.04 atau 24.04 (VPS Hiddence direkomendasikan)
  • Akses root atau sudo ke server
  • Nama domain yang mengarah ke IP server Anda (opsional tetapi direkomendasikan untuk TLS)
  • Pengetahuan dasar baris perintah

Langkah 1: Siapkan Server Anda

Pertama, perbarui sistem Anda dan instal Docker (Marzban berjalan dalam container Docker):

bash
# Perbarui sistem
apt update && apt upgrade -y

# Instal Docker
curl -fsSL https://get.docker.com | sh

# Instal Docker Compose
apt install docker-compose -y

# Verifikasi instalasi Docker
docker --version
docker-compose --version

Langkah 2: Instal Marzban

Unduh dan instal Marzban menggunakan skrip instalasi resmi:

bash
# Buat direktori untuk Marzban
mkdir -p /opt/marzban
cd /opt/marzban

# Unduh file docker-compose
wget -O docker-compose.yml https://raw.githubusercontent.com/Gozargah/Marzban/master/docker-compose.yml

# Buat file .env untuk konfigurasi
wget -O .env https://raw.githubusercontent.com/Gozargah/Marzban/master/.env.example

# Edit .env untuk mengatur kredensial admin
nano .env
# Setel SUDO_USERNAME dan SUDO_PASSWORD

# Mulai Marzban
docker-compose up -d

# Periksa apakah berjalan
docker-compose ps

Langkah 3: Akses Dasbor Marzban

Buka browser Anda dan navigasikan ke alamat IP server Anda pada port 8000:

  • URL: http://IP_SERVER_ANDA:8000
  • Masuk dengan nama pengguna dan kata sandi yang Anda setel di file .env
  • Anda akan melihat dasbor Marzban dengan opsi untuk pengguna, pengaturan, dan statistik
  • Penting: Ubah kata sandi admin default segera setelah masuk pertama kali

Langkah 4: Konfigurasikan VLESS Inbound

Atur protokol VLESS di Marzban:

  • Di dasbor, buka 'Pengaturan Inti' atau 'Inbound'
  • Tambahkan inbound VLESS baru dengan pengaturan berikut:
  • Port: 443 (untuk TLS) atau port yang tersedia
  • Protokol: VLESS
  • Jaringan: TCP atau WS (WebSocket)
  • Keamanan: TLS (jika menggunakan domain) atau Reality
  • Jika menggunakan Reality, konfigurasikan SNI ke situs populer seperti www.microsoft.com
  • Simpan konfigurasi inbound

Langkah 5: Buat Pengguna dan Hasilkan Tautan

Tambahkan pengguna proxy dan dapatkan tautan koneksi:

  • Klik tombol 'Tambah Pengguna' di dasbor
  • Setel nama pengguna, batas lalu lintas, dan tanggal kedaluwarsa
  • Pilih inbound VLESS yang Anda buat
  • Klik 'Buat' untuk menghasilkan pengguna
  • Salin tautan langganan atau kode QR
  • Impor tautan ke klien VLESS Anda (v2rayN, v2rayNG, Hiddify, dll.)
  • Uji koneksi dengan mengaktifkan proxy

Praktik Terbaik Marzban

  • Aktifkan integrasi bot Telegram untuk manajemen pengguna yang mudah
  • Atur sertifikat SSL untuk akses dasbor yang aman (gunakan reverse proxy Nginx)
  • Cadangkan database Marzban secara teratur (/opt/marzban/db.sqlite3)
  • Pantau lalu lintas pengguna untuk mencegah penyalahgunaan
  • Gunakan protokol Reality untuk resistensi sensor maksimum
  • Jaga Marzban tetap diperbarui: docker-compose pull && docker-compose up -d
  • Konfigurasikan firewall untuk mengizinkan hanya port yang diperlukan (443, 8000)
  • Gunakan kata sandi yang kuat untuk akun admin